发表评论取消回复
相关阅读
相关 Java集合框架:并发访问问题案例分析
在Java的集合框架中,并发访问是一个常见的并发问题。下面我们将通过一个具体的案例来分析这个问题。 案例描述: 假设我们有一个`ArrayList<String>``list
相关 理解和解决Java集合框架中的并发更新问题
在Java的集合框架中,如果多个线程同时尝试修改一个集合,就可能出现并发更新的问题。以下是一些常见的解决方案: 1. **同步(Synchronized)**:使用`sync
相关 Java集合框架:并发修改问题案例
在Java集合框架中,由于并发环境下的多线程操作,可能会出现数据不一致的问题。下面以ArrayList的add方法为例,介绍一个并发修改问题案例: ```java impor
相关 Java集合框架中的ConcurrentHashMap并发更新问题
`ConcurrentHashMap` 是 Java集合框架中提供的一个线程安全的哈希表。它允许多个线程同时访问和更新映射,而不需要使用同步锁。`ConcurrentHashM
相关 Java集合框架疑惑:为什么会出现并发更新问题?
Java集合框架中的并发更新问题通常指的是在多线程环境下,多个线程同时对同一个集合进行修改(如添加、删除元素)时,由于缺乏适当的同步控制,导致集合的状态出现不一致的问题。以下是
相关 Java集合框架中的并发问题案例
在Java集合框架中,由于多线程的存在,可能会出现各种并发问题。以下是一些常见的案例: 1. 线程安全的ArrayList 使用`Collections.synchro
相关 Java集合框架:并发更新问题案例
在Java的集合框架中,如果多个线程同时尝试更新同一个集合元素,可能会出现并发更新的问题。 以下是一个简单的例子: ```java import java.util.con
相关 Java集合框架的并发问题案例
在Java集合框架中,如果多线程访问集合且没有正确的同步机制,就可能导致严重的并发问题。以下是一些典型的案例: 1. **ConcurrentModificationExce
相关 Java集合框架:List和Set的并发更新问题
在Java的集合框架中,List和Set都是线程不安全的。这意味着如果你在一个多线程环境中对它们进行并发修改,可能会出现数据不一致的问题。 例如,如果一个线程正在向尾添加元素
相关 Java集合框架中的并发更新问题——实例探讨
在Java的集合框架中,尤其是在多线程环境下,很容易出现并发更新的问题。下面通过一个实例来详细解释这一现象。 假设我们有一个`ArrayList<String>`,名为`my
还没有评论,来说两句吧...